In the months leading up to the release of Core 2 Duo processor - also referred to as “Conroe” for desktops - many questions remained unanswered. Did Intel make the necessary changes to compete with AMD’s processor advantage?
The Core 2 Duo is the successor of NetBurst micro-architecture that has powered most Intel processors since 2000.
